Transaction 16a668c183c55f426f58db04303e53a9e4ad72ac9359ec262cfd2a8f966f8719
1 Input
1 Output
-
16a668c183c55f426f58db04303e53a9e4ad72ac9359ec262cfd2a8f966f8719:0
- value
- 537839
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f1268fb3db4645fc054ecf4a9dc826aafe77456 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13qJ16uPJXEJCdbJZcvbS1b6zMRBi2cHHZ